Multifunction ovens
Multifunction ovens permit you to cook different food items in various ways, including roasting, grilling, and baking. They also often include extra functions for certain foods, such as dough proving, slow cook and defrost options that operate without heat. You may also get extra features like a rotisserie or vapour-cleaning cycles, and the option to add an optional temperature probe to allow for more precise cooking of meat.
Multifunction ovens can be equipped with a range of cooking functions. These can be controlled by an adjustment dial and displayed on an LCD touchscreen display. Certain models come with a child lock to keep children from messing up the settings. Other models offer a range of connectivity features, such as wi-fi and an application that allows you to make use of your smartphone to remotely manage certain functions.
If you're in the market for a multifunction stove, make sure it is compatible with the fuel of preference, whether that's electricity or gas. It should be installed by a licensed technician to ensure security. You'll also need an appropriate space for the oven that is free of obstructions, such as radiators, and that it has a door that is able to fully open. It is also possible to consider a model with stay-clean liners catalytically converted into self-cleaning machines when set to high temperatures.
Certain models have Telescopic runners that allow you to move the wire shelves back and forth to provide greater flexibility in your storage space. These are available in mid-range and premium models.
